diff --git a/libavcodec/error_resilience.c b/libavcodec/error_resilience.c index 584bac865ea4a46191afde5eaa1e6b51207f7684..3cb8d40bcf11b45581cf7aaca4098ce379cec6c7 100644 --- a/libavcodec/error_resilience.c +++ b/libavcodec/error_resilience.c @@ -528,6 +528,8 @@ score_sum+= best_score; static int is_intra_more_likely(MpegEncContext *s){ int is_intra_likely, i, j, undamaged_count, skip_amount, mb_x, mb_y; + + if(s->last_picture.data[0]==NULL) return 1; //no previous frame available -> use spatial prediction undamaged_count=0; for(i=0; imb_num; i++){